Wales will host England behind-closed-doors in Llanelli, it has been confirmed, after lockdown rules meant the WRU had to scrap a plan to play at Tottenham.
If socially-distanced fans were allowed the Welsh union were keen to stage the ‘home’ game at Spurs’ new ground to maximise revenue.
But with no government go-ahead for a significant number to attend sporting matches Wales have reverted to plan B and will face their old foes at Parc y Scarlets on November 28.

The move confirms that the WRU will miss out on more vital revenue.
